Historical Description

WHICKHAM, anciently “Quicham” or “Quykham,” is a parish, situated on the road from Newcastle to Shotley Bridge and about 2 miles from the river Tyne, 3 ½ miles west-south-west from Gateshead, in the Chester-le-Street division of the county, west division of Chester ward, Gateshead union and petty sessional division, county court district of Newcastle-on-Tyne, rural deanery of Ryton and archdeaconry and diocese of Durham. The Local Government Act (1858), 21 and 22 Viet. c. 98, was adopted here March 23, 1875. The district is controlled by a Local Board of Health of 12 members. The church of St. Mary is an ancient edifice of stone in the Norman and Transition styles, consisting of chancel, nave of three bays, aisles and a low embattled western tower, containing a clock and 6 bells, three of which, with the clock, were presented in 1889, at a cost of upwards of £300, in memory of the late R. Carr-Ellison esq. of Dunston hill: the chancel arch is Norman and has cushion capitals enriched with a flower ornament: on the north side of the arch is a hagiscope; the arcades are Transitional, and there is an early font: in the church is a monument to Robert Thomlinson D.D. prebendary of St. Paul’s, and 36 years rector here, d. 24 March, 1747; there are mural monuments to Sir James Clavering, of Axwell bart; Sir Thomas Clavering, of Axwell bart. ob. October 1794, and Martha his wife, ob. 16 August, 1792: in the chancel is a memorial window erected by the late Mr. Joseph A. Hymers to his wife, and there are four other stained windows: the organ was introduced in 1869, and in 1875 a reredos was erected by Ralph Brown esq, of Benwell Tower, Newcastle-on-Tyne: the church was thoroughly restored in 1862 at a cost of £2,700, and has sittings for 550 persons. At the west end of the churchyard are two grave slabs removed from a field in the parish in 1784, by Mr. Robert. Hodgson, druggist, of London; they respectively bear marginal inscriptions to George Hodgson, ob. 1 December, 1667, and Aibiah, his daughter, ob. 6 February, 1669. The register dates from the year 1576. The living is a rectory, average tithe rent-charge £339, net yearly value £391, including 117 acres of glebe, with residence, in the gift of the Lord Chancellor, and held since 1846 by the Rev. Henry Byne Carr M.A. of University College, Oxford, hon. canon of Durham and surrogate. There are Wesleyan and Primitive Methodist chapels and a Wesleyan chapel at Fellside. The charities are about £30 yearly value. Gibside, situated about 2 miles from Whickham church, was anciently held by the Marley and Blakiston families: the mansion is a noble edifice of stone, delightfully situated on the banks of the Derwent, amidst a forest of plantations, but is at present (1889) unoccupied; the south front, which has been rebuilt, is embattled and has mullioned bay windows; in the drawing-room is a fine mantelpiece, supported by terminal figures of Samson and Hercules, and above are the arms of Sir William Blakiston, who died in February, 1607-8, and was buried at Whickham. East of the house, a handsome Doric column, 140 feet in height, surmounted by a figure of Liberty 12 feet high, stands conspicuously in the grounds. Nature and Art have combined to make the scenery in the locality attractive. The Ecclesiastical Commissioners are lords of the manor, and the Earl of Ravensworth, Capt. Sir Henry Augustus Clavering bart. R.N. of Axwell Park, and the trustees of the lale John Bowes esq. D.L. of Streatlam Castle, and John Ralph Carr-Ellison esq. J.P. of Dunston Hill, are the chief landowners. The soil is clay and loam; subsoil, sandstone. The chief crops are wheat, barley oats and pasture. The area of the parish is 5,993 acres; rateable value, £28,334. The population in 1871 was 6,482 and in 1881, 7,975.

A School Board of 7 members was formed 26 March, 1873; the board meets in the parish offices on the first Monday in the month; William Willis, clerk.

National School, Whickham, Tomlinson & Blakiston Endowed Schools (mixed), for 130 boys & 120 girls; average attendance, 99 boys & 94 girls.

Kelly's Directory of Durham (1890)
